Guru Nanak Dev Univeristy is conducting a short term course on 'posttranscriptional control of gene expression in eukaryotes.' Eukaryotes is an organism consisting of a cell or cells in which the genetic material is DNA in the form of chromosomes contained within a distinct nucleus.
This course will provide a background in concepts and will include an overview of current
experimental approaches that are used to study aspects of posttranscriptional regulation.
Upon completion of the course, participants will:
1. Be familiar with the current state of knowledge of mechanisms of mRNA biogenesis,
processing, functioning, and turnover.
2. Understand the methodology behind the advances and current study of
posttranscriptional control mechanisms.
3. Be cognizant of the theoretical underpinnings of the field.
4. Be able to formulate and test hypotheses that pertain to the role(s) that
posttranscriptional control may play in gene expression.
